WHAT WILL I STUDY?

This program focuses on the most in-demand areas of technology, including:

  • JavaScript – Discover one of the world’s most widely used programming languages for building interactive websites and applications.
  • Object Oriented Programming (OOP) – Understand the core principles that drive modern software solutions, from mobile applications to enterprise systems.
  • Project Management – Gain the skills to plan, manage, and successfully deliver software projects.
  • Robot Technology – Explore how automation and robotics are reshaping industries and discover their practical applications.
  • Software Testing – Learn techniques to ensure quality, efficiency, and reliability in software development.

By the end of the course, you will feel confident applying software development skills to create, manage, and deliver digital solutions effectively.

FEES

Adults - Level 3

This course may be free if you meet certain conditions:

  • If you are not working or have a low income. You need to show proof of your income or benefits.
  • If you are aged 19-23 and you do not have a full Level 3 qualification (a full L3 is the equivalent of two A-levels at A* - E grade). You need to show us proof of any qualifications you already have.
  • Residency rules apply. You need to show you have permission to live, work and study in the UK without conditions if you live in London, or 3 years if you live outside London.
  • There are some exceptions, such as certain visa types.

Check here which documents you need to show us, and which visa types are allowed.

If you do not meet the residency rules, you can still enrol on the course but you may have to pay some fees. All applicants are fee-assessed during enrolment.

If you are not eligible for a free or reduced-cost course, you need to pay the full fee yourself, or apply for an Advanced Learner Loan.
